πŸ₯˜ Ingredients

12 items
  • 1 cup All-purpose flour
  • 1 cup Cornmeal
  • 0.75 cup Granulated sugar
  • 2 teaspoons Baking powder
  • 0.5 teaspoon Baking soda
  • 0.5 teaspoon Salt
  • 1 cup Buttermilk
  • 0.25 cup Unsalted butter, melted and slightly cooled
  • 1 whole Large egg
  • 1 teaspoon Vanilla extract
  • 1 cup Fresh or frozen cranberries, coarsely chopped
  • 1 teaspoon Orange zest

πŸ“ Instructions

9 steps
1

Preheat your oven to 375Β°F (190Β°C) and prepare a 12-cup muffin tin by lining it with paper liners or lightly greasing each cup.

2

In a large mixing bowl, whisk together the all-purpose flour, cornmeal, granulated sugar, baking powder, baking soda, and salt until well combined.

3

In a medium bowl, whisk together the buttermilk, melted butter, egg, and vanilla extract until smooth.

4

Gradually pour the wet ingredients into the dry ingredients, stirring gently with a spatula until just combined. Be careful not to overmix; a few lumps are okay.

5

Fold in the chopped cranberries and orange zest, distributing them evenly throughout the batter.

6

Divide the batter evenly among the prepared muffin cups, filling each about 3/4 full.

7

Bake the muffins in the preheated oven for 18-20 minutes, or until the tops are golden and a toothpick inserted into the center of a muffin comes out clean.

8

Remove the muffins from the oven and let them cool in the pan for 5 minutes before transferring them to a wire rack to cool completely.

9

Serve the muffins warm or at room temperature. Enjoy!
